This is a beautiful Beige & Sage Swiss Wash Hand Knotted Michaelian & Kohlberg Wool Rug. The wool not only adds to rug's durability, but also provides dirt repelling quality and thermal insulation. Swiss wash is a unique finishing treatment provided to rugs in Switzerland. It implies a thorough cleaning that removes all loose fibers and debris from the rug. The final product is a rug with a singular wool finish. The difference is comparable to the one between basic manicure and Shellac manicure. Its elegant style is easy to decorate with and perfect for living room, dining room, bedroom or anywhere in the residence or office.About Michaelian & Kohlberg Rugs: Michaelian & Kohlberg have been a source of fine hand knotted rugs since 1921. Their name is synonymous with rugs that combine time honored weaving techniques, innovative designs, and sophisticated color palette. With designs that range from traditional to ultra contemporary, Michaelian & Kohlberg carpets create a beautiful and luxurious foundation for today’s finest interiors. Since the 1980's, Michaelian and Kohlberg has been involved in projects that have been credited for reviving the art and craft of natural dyeing and hand-spinning in Turkey, India, Nepal, China, Afghanistan and elsewhere. In fact, Metropolitan Museum of Art, New York actively hosts many antique rugs from its founder Frank Michaelian's collection. Today, Michaelian & Kohlberg rugs are standard bearers of quality, technique, and innovative design in the hand knotted flooring industry.
Antique Chinese Deco Rug, Origin: China, Circa: Early 20th Century – Here is an exciting and appealing antique Oriental carpet – an antique Art Deco rug that was designed and woven in China during the early years of the twentieth century. Heavily informed by the aesthetic inclinations of the Art Deco period, this unique carpet is a compelling and thought-provoking example. A scalloped Purple encloses a Light Green sand field on this exquisitely subtle and restrained antique Chinese Art Deco. At first the field appears empty or open, but it is actually covered by a tone-on-tone design of scrolls and cloud-bands emanating inward from the outer edges. In their sinuous rhythms they echo the scalloped forms of the border and continue its visual effects across the carpet in a more subdued manner. This carpet testifies to the masterful design sensibilities of Chinese weavers as they made the transition into the modern world. The Art Deco movement had an outside influence on the world of art and design, and some of the most important qualities and characteristics of that movement may be found in this fine rug.

Vital and vibrant, this wondrous antique embroidered textile from Greece is alive with the cultural richness of folk-art traditions from a country famous for its illustrious civilizations and artisans. It has a linen foundation with wool embroidery. Sophisticated repeating figures and creative crewelwork designs create a stunning mutable pattern divided into directional segments that face a distinctive focal point. Mythical gryphons give way to a forest of meandering grapevines with leafy ornaments. Dramatic stags and geometric animals follow the botanical ornaments and lead to a series of colorful horses and riders that are followed by dancing people. Compound ram’s horns, which resemble recurving leaflets, and lozenge-shaped burdock symbols that become geometric flowers fill the decorative borders while hinting at the ancient origins of these familiar motifs that are part of a universal design language.

This magnificent antique Khotan carpet from East Turkestan with a background was produced in the late 19th century. The magnificent antique Khotan rugs are from a city that was once an important trading center that is situated along the old iconic silk road. Area rugs from this area were influenced by Persian rugs as well as Turkish rug designs in addition to. This allowed the weavers to create unique designs by incorporating their own interpretations of these artistic deign elements.
